Re: patch to configure script



  In message <3436292b0.198f@htbrug.net.HCC.nl>you write:
  > I have made a small change to the configure script. I use the gnu m4
  > macro processor only for autoconf. Using gnu m4 would require a lot of
  > testing of current software that I don't want to do. The patch below
  > checks for gm4 gnum4 and m4 executables. This is the same sequence as
  > autoconf uses in its configuration script.
I don't see anything particularly wrong with your patch.  However, I
wonder exactly what problem you're trying to solve.

It shouldn't be necessary for you to need m4 to build egcs -- unless
your actually making patches to configure.in and friends.  Is that
the case you're trying to make work better for you?
